Prohibits the issuance of violations or tickets during certain weekend hours to residential occupants for violations of the sanitation department regulations regarding placing trash or garbage out for collection earlier than allowed under the city routing system designated hours.
Summary
Bill A02693 amends the administrative code of New York City to prohibit the issuance of tickets or violations to residential occupants for specific sanitation code violations. Specifically, it targets violations related to the timing of placing refuse, solid waste, or recyclable materials out for collection. Under this bill, no notices of violation or tickets can be issued to owners, lessees, tenants, or occupants of residential buildings for violations occurring between 3:00 p.m. on Friday and 6:00 p.m. on Saturday. This aims to provide residents with more flexibility during the weekend regarding waste disposal.
Impact
The bill significantly alters the enforcement of sanitation regulations in New York City by providing a grace period during the weekends for residents concerning waste disposal. This change may reduce the number of tickets issued to residents, which could alleviate financial burdens on households and potentially decrease the administrative workload for the sanitation department. It also reflects a shift towards more lenient enforcement of sanitation codes during specific hours, which could influence future regulatory approaches.
Sentiment
The sentiment surrounding Bill A02693 appears to be positive, as evidenced by the unanimous support it received in committee votes. The bill passed through the Assembly Cities Committee, Ways and Means Committee, and Rules Committee without any opposition, indicating a consensus on its benefits for residential occupants. Stakeholders seem to appreciate the flexibility it offers to residents during the weekends.
